Unknown person threw a bottle of fuel in Lviv synagogue

Lviv police investigate the circumstances of the incident that occurred on the night of June 30 in Lviv, when an unknown person threw the bottle with an unidentified flammable substance at the street wall of the synagogue in Lviv.

As have informed Agency in Department of the Main Directorate of the National Police in the Lviv region, according to the guard, who was questioned by police, the bottle hit the wall and broke, then there was a fire, but the fire was small and was soon extinguished itself. According to the guard, the incident occurred at about 4 a.m., he called the police only at 6.30 approx.

The Lviv City Council condemned the incident. “The perpetrators must be brought to justice. We appeal to law enforcement structures to investigate these events as quickly as possible. Lviv has always been a tolerant city,” the press service quoted the words of Deputy Mayor Andriy Moskalenko.
